Michael V. Klibanov is an academic researcher from University of North Carolina at Charlotte. The author has contributed to research in topics: Inverse problem & Inverse scattering problem. The author has an hindex of 42, co-authored 245 publications receiving 6166 citations. Previous affiliations of Michael V. Klibanov include University of North Carolina at Chapel Hill & Chalmers University of Technology.

Book

Carleman Estimates for Coefficient Inverse Problems and Numerical Applications

TL;DR: In this article, the main subject of the author's considerations is coefficient inverse problems, which consist of determining the variable coefficients of a certain differential operator defined in a domain from boundary measurements of a solution or its functionals.
Journal ArticleDOI

Inverse problems and Carleman estimates

TL;DR: In this article, a method for proving global uniqueness theorems for one broad class of multidimensional coefficient inverse problems is described. But this method is based on Carleman estimates and does not depend essentially on the order or type of differential operator.
Book

Approximate Global Convergence and Adaptivity for Coefficient Inverse Problems

TL;DR: In this paper, two new concepts of numerical solutions of multidimensional Coefficient Inverse Problems (CIPs) for a hyperbolic Partial Differential Equation (PDE) are presented: approximate global convergence and adaptive finite element method (adaptivity for brevity).
Journal ArticleDOI

Carleman estimates for global uniqueness, stability and numerical methods for coefficient inverse problems

TL;DR: A review paper of the role of Carleman estimates in the theory of multidimensional Coefficient Inverse Problems since the first inception of this idea in 1981 is given in this article.
